Really suddenly came the introduction, just like that, days before the end of the activity of this parliament, a bill of GERB and DPS to ban the advertising of gambling . Quite a strong restriction and ban.

I personally admit that I had such a shameful, gambling period in my life, which I managed then, more than 20 years ago, to stop before I fell into a state of addiction. Only with a will, but I have a lot of that, and it wasn't easy at all.

I don't feel like it was the gambling ad that brought me to the gym, but I was there and I admit it, with all the shame I feel about it.

Now to the question.

Many people, including myself, have repeatedly spoken about Borissov's existing control over televisions.

These things are delicate, hard to prove, but the general feeling, especially before 2020, was that Borisov had such invisible control.

Preserving this control, or at least what is left of it, cannot but be the supreme personal task of Borisov and Peevski.

And right at that moment, suddenly out of nowhere, they are the ones who hit the TVs they want to rule with this tesla.

Something seems to me like a conflict with their own interests.

I also carefully read the analyzes saying that they /probably the two of them/ in this way lower the price of one of the television operators, which was in the process of sale.

It may be so, but the sale is somewhere in time, and the campaign that will rearrange the Bulgarian parliament has already started. And there is no way the “television” and the advertising business not to be “outraged” of this, “with all the means at their disposal”.
